[Bug 906182] Re: Using a comma in the unknown language forces the clause after the comma into the Second Answer field

 

Thanks you for helping the OpenTeacher project by filing this bug!

We (the OpenTeacher devs) agree this is a problem which exists in both
our 2.x and 3.x series. We'll fix it differently in both series probably
since they differ from each other when entering words.

The 2.x solution will be:
- having the possibility to 'escape' characters by prefixing them with '\'. By doing that, they're not used to determine the next answer.
- having the ';', ',' and '=' characters inside the 'onscreen keyboard' (the thing on the right side of the screen), which will automatically insert '\;', '\,' and '\=' respectively.

We've not yet agreed about a 3.x solution, but that one will follow :).

Bug description:
  If you want to use OpenTeacher to learn sentences there is a problem
  if the sentence contains a comma. The sentence in the Unknown (Answer)
  Language is split at the comma with the words after the comma being
  placed into the Second Answer field.  A "work around" is to edit the
  .ot file in a text editor but it might be nicer if this wasn't
  necessary.
